Aggregate repair services involve restoring and maintaining the integrity of various types of aggregate surfaces, such as concrete, asphalt, or stone. These services typically include patching, resurfacing, crack filling, and sealing to address surface damage and deterioration. The goal is to improve the appearance, safety, and longevity of the surface by addressing issues like surface erosion, spalling, or cracking that can develop over time due to weather, traffic, or other environmental factors.
These repair services help resolve common problems associated with aggregate surfaces, including cracks that can lead to further deterioration, uneven surfaces that pose safety hazards, and surface wear that diminishes aesthetic appeal. Repairing damaged areas prevents issues from worsening, reduces the risk of accidents, and extends the lifespan of the surface. Proper maintenance and timely repairs can also help avoid more extensive and costly replacements in the future.

What is aggregate repair? Aggregate repair involves fixing damaged or deteriorated aggregate surfaces, such as driveways, walkways, or parking lots, to restore their appearance and functionality.
How do professionals perform aggregate repair? Local service providers typically assess the damage, remove loose or broken aggregate, and replace or reapply material to ensure a smooth, durable surface.
What types of aggregate surfaces can be repaired? Repair services are available for various aggregate surfaces, including concrete, asphalt, and stone-based pavements.
How long does aggregate repair usually take? The duration depends on the extent of damage, but many repairs can be completed within a few hours to a day.
